随着外卖行业进入深度发展阶段,用户对配送时效、服务体验的要求不断提升,传统的人工调度与粗放式管理已难以应对复杂的订单高峰和动态变化的路况。在此背景下,外卖配送系统开发不再仅仅是功能堆砌,而是演变为一场围绕效率、稳定与智能化的系统性工程。企业若想在竞争激烈的市场中脱颖而出,必须从底层架构出发,构建一套真正具备高响应能力、强扩展性和安全性的智能配送体系。这不仅关乎用户体验,更直接影响平台的运营成本与商业可持续性。
订单调度算法:智能决策的核心引擎
订单调度是整个配送系统的心脏。一个高效的调度算法需综合考虑骑手位置、订单距离、订单优先级、骑手负荷、历史配送时长等多重因素,实现“最优匹配”。若仅依赖静态规则或人工分配,极易导致部分区域骑手积压、某些订单长时间无人接单。当前主流做法是引入基于机器学习的动态调度模型,通过实时分析历史数据与实时状态,预测各区域需求波动,提前调配运力资源。例如,系统可在午餐高峰期前自动向热门商圈推送更多骑手,避免“爆单”瘫痪。同时,算法还应支持弹性调整,如临时取消订单后快速重新派单,确保整体流程不中断。
实时定位与路径优化:提升准时率的关键
骑手的实时位置追踪与动态路径规划直接影响配送时效。传统的固定路线规划在面对突发交通拥堵、临时封路等情况时显得捉襟见肘。现代系统普遍采用高精度定位技术(如GPS+基站融合)结合AI路径优化引擎,能够每分钟更新一次最优路径,并根据实时路况自动重算。部分领先平台甚至接入城市交通大数据接口,实现“红绿灯预测”与“避堵策略”,显著降低平均配送时间。此外,系统还需支持多终点路径优化,即同一骑手可完成多个顺路订单,减少空驶里程,提高单位时间配送量。

多端协同机制:打通全链路信息壁垒
外卖配送涉及商家端、用户端、骑手端及后台管理系统,四端之间的信息同步是否及时、准确,直接决定整体效率。一旦某一环节出现延迟或信息不同步,就可能引发用户投诉、骑手误解或商家备餐延误。因此,构建统一的消息中心与事件驱动机制至关重要。通过消息队列(如Kafka)实现异步通信,确保订单状态变更能以毫秒级速度推送到所有相关方。同时,各端应具备离线处理能力,即使网络短暂中断也能保留操作记录,待恢复后自动补发,保障业务连续性。
数据安全与隐私保护:不可忽视的底线要求
在系统运行过程中,大量敏感数据被采集与传输——包括用户地址、手机号、骑手位置轨迹、交易金额等。一旦发生泄露,将带来严重的法律风险与品牌信任危机。因此,在开发阶段就必须将安全作为核心设计原则。建议采用端到端加密、敏感字段脱敏存储、权限分级控制等措施。对于骑手位置数据,应仅在必要时暴露最小范围坐标,避免长期暴露完整轨迹。同时,系统需符合《个人信息保护法》等相关法规要求,建立数据生命周期管理制度,定期审计日志,确保合规运营。
可扩展的微服务架构:支撑未来增长的技术基石
面对业务快速增长与功能迭代频繁的挑战,单体架构已无法满足灵活部署与快速迭代的需求。采用微服务架构,将订单管理、调度引擎、支付模块、通知服务等拆分为独立的服务单元,每个服务可独立开发、测试、部署与扩容。借助容器化技术(如Docker + Kubernetes),系统可根据负载情况自动伸缩,实现资源利用率最大化。更重要的是,当某项功能需要升级时,不会影响其他模块的正常运行,极大提升了系统的稳定性与维护效率。
与第三方平台的接口兼容性:拓展生态能力的基础
大多数外卖平台并非孤立运行,而是需要对接支付网关、地图服务、短信/语音通知平台、物流合作伙伴等外部系统。良好的接口设计应遵循标准化协议(如RESTful API),并提供详细的文档与沙箱环境供开发者测试。同时,系统需具备容错与降级机制,当第三方服务不可用时,仍能维持基本功能运转,避免全链路崩溃。例如,当短信平台宕机时,系统可自动切换至邮件通知或本地缓存提醒,保障用户知情权。
综上所述,外卖配送系统开发绝非简单的功能实现,而是一项涵盖算法、架构、安全、协同与生态的系统工程。只有将上述核心要素有机整合,才能真正构建出高效、稳定、可扩展的智能配送体系。实践表明,合理应用这些技术手段,可使配送成本下降20%以上,准时率提升至95%以上,用户满意度显著增强,进而带动更高的留存率与复购率。对于希望打造差异化竞争力的企业而言,从源头做好系统设计,是迈向规模化成功的关键一步。我们专注于为餐饮及零售企业提供定制化的外卖配送系统开发服务,基于多年实战经验,已成功交付多个高并发、低延迟的智能调度项目,团队擅长微服务架构设计与AI算法集成,支持全流程技术落地与运维保障,有相关需求可直接联系17723342546
